Air Supply 1

 
The new Cambridge Fire "Air Supply/Incident Support Unit" is mounted on a Ford F550, 4-wheel drive chassis (the former tech rescue trailer prime mover). The unit carries 50 spare air cylinders & a cascade system with the capability to refill approx 50 additional cylinders. This apparatus also carries a portable generator, portable scene lights, portable light towers, a portable canopy, several fire extinguishers of various classes, a thawing device, ice melt, hot weather & cold weather rehab supplies (ice packs, wipes, gloves, etc.), & much more.
Thank you to our Fire Apparatus Fleet Mechanics & Tech Services for professionally fitting out this multi-purpose air supply/support unit.

Air Supply 1 was placed in service on March 17, 2026.

Dive 1

Dive 1 is a Ford F450/Road Rescue, four wheel drive & replaces an older Dive Rescue apparatus.It will be utilized to support the CFD firefighter divers in underwater search & rescue operations. Rescue 2 - USAR Truck

This USAR (Urban Search and Rescue) truck built by Marion on a Freightliner chassis, is fully equipped for response to major incidents in Cambridge as well as in the Metro area. Rescue 2 will be cross-staffed by the members of Rescue 1 & members of the Tech Rescue squads & companies (Engine 1, Ladder 1, Squads 2, 3, an 4), responding by special call as needed.

The new Rescue 2 was placed in service on July 11, 2025.

HazMat 1

HazMat 1 is an Electric Vehicle (EV), built by Rosenbauer Group on a 2023 International chassis. The apparatus includes a command post with electronic research library and is fully equipped to support our Cambridge Fire Hazardous Materials Task Force at hazardous materials incidents in the city as well as in our mutual aid communities as needed.
Equipment carried includes sampling meters & kits to test gaseous, liquid, & solid products; radiation meters; personal protective equipment (entry suits, self-contained breathing apparatus, boots, gloves); containment equipment (booms, absorbent materials, drums, patches, plugs, & diking materials); hand tools (non-sparking wrenches, mallets, shovels, brooms, brushes); decontamination equipment; and much, much more. The truck also includes a roof-mounted light tower for use during night or low-visibility operations.
The truck was purchased with funds allocated by the Massachusetts Department of Fire Services
This apparatus is believed to be the first Electric Powered Fire Apparatus in service in New England!

Spare Ladder 5 - (fomer Ladder 4)

2002 Pierce "Dash 2000" 105 foot heavy duty rear-mount aerial ladder (former Ladder 4). This truck, designated as a spare, was totally rebuilt at the Pierce manufacturing facility in 2021. Note the truck changeable number inserts, e.g. Ladder 3 in this photo.
